尤其当谈及与先进处理器架构(APU,即加速处理单元,融合了CPU与GPU功能)的兼容性和性能优化时,Arch Linux更是展现出了无可比拟的优势
本文将深入探讨Arch Linux如何成为APU性能释放的极致之选,以及它为用户和开发者带来的独特价值
一、Arch Linux的核心优势 1.滚动发布模型 Arch Linux采用滚动发布(Rolling Release)模式,这意味着它始终保持着最新的软件包和内核版本
这种机制确保了Arch Linux能够迅速集成最新的硬件支持、性能优化和安全补丁
对于APU这类集成了高性能计算与图形处理能力的先进硬件而言,最新的Linux内核和驱动程序至关重要,因为它们能够充分发挥硬件的潜能,减少延迟,提升整体系统性能
2.强大的社区支持 Arch Linux拥有一个活跃且技术精湛的社区,用户可以在Arch Linux论坛、Wiki和IRC频道中找到丰富的文档、教程和解决方案
社区成员不仅乐于分享知识,还积极参与软件包维护和开发,确保Arch Linux的生态系统持续繁荣
对于APU用户而言,这意味着他们能够快速获得针对其硬件优化的指南、脚本和补丁,从而最大化利用硬件资源
3.高度可定制性 Arch Linux的安装过程被誉为“Linux世界的瑞士军刀”,因为它提供了前所未有的自定义选项
用户可以从最基础的安装开始,根据自己的需求选择软件包、内核配置和文件系统类型等
这种灵活性对于APU用户尤为重要,因为他们可以根据具体的硬件特性和应用场景,调整系统配置以达到最佳性能表现
二、Arch Linux与APU的深度整合 1.内核优化 Arch Linux的滚动发布特性确保了它总是包含最新的Linux内核,这对于APU的支持至关重要
新内核版本不仅修复了旧版本中的漏洞,还引入了针对新硬件的改进和优化
例如,Linux内核近年来加强了对异构计算的支持,包括AMD的APU,通过改进调度算法、增强电源管理和优化内存访问路径,显著提升了APU的计算效率和图形处理能力
2.驱动程序更新 Arch Linux的官方软件仓库(Arch User Repository, AUR)和社区维护的仓库提供了大量最新的驱动程序和工具,特别是针对APU的专用驱动程序
这些驱动程序经过精心编写和测试,以确保与最新硬件版本的兼容性,并提供最佳的性能和稳定性
用户只需简单地安装相应的软件包,即可享受到针对其APU优化的图形加速、视频编码解码和电源管理功能
3.性能调优工具 Arch Linux社区开发了一系列性能调优工具,如`phc-intel`用于调节Intel处理器的频率,`tlp`用于电源管理优化,以及`perf`和`sysbench`等用于系统性能分析和基准测试的工具
对于APU用户来说,这些工具能够帮助他们深入了解系统的运行状态,识别潜在的性能瓶颈,并采取相应的优化措施,从而提升整体系统响应速度和任务处理效率
三、Arch Linux在APU应用中的实际案例 1.游戏性能提升 许多游戏玩家选择Arch Linux作为他们的操作系统,原因之一就是其出色的游戏性能
APU的集成GPU虽然不如独立显卡强大,但在轻量级游戏和电子竞技中仍能发挥重要作用
Arch Linux通过提供最新的AMD GPU驱动程序、Vulkan支持以及优化的游戏库,使得APU用户能够享受到流畅的游戏体验
此外,Arch Linux还支持Wine和Proton等兼容层,让Windows平台的游戏也能在Linux上运行
2.多媒体创作 对于视频编辑、3D建模和动画制作等多媒体创作领域,APU的异构计算能力显得尤为重要
Arch Linux通过集成OpenCL、Vulkan和AMD APP SDK等框架,为开发者提供了强大的计算加速工具
结合高效的Linux应用程序,如Blender、Kdenlive和Ardour,A
Hyper Pay App下载指南:轻松支付新体验
Arch Linux:探索APU性能优化新境界
揭秘:通货膨胀至极,hyper inflation来袭
Linux信号机制:高效处理中断技巧
Linux地球:探索开源世界的奥秘
Hyper性能下滑:原因与对策揭秘
“Hyper Sexualized”社会现象下的文化反思:新媒体时代的性符号滥用与道德边界这个标
Linux信号机制:高效处理中断技巧
Linux地球:探索开源世界的奥秘
解决Linux FTP无上传权限问题:步骤与技巧
Linux系统下光纤扫描实战指南
iPhone上运行Bochs Linux教程
Linux userdel命令:轻松管理用户账户
Linux环境下JLink调试技巧与实战指南
Linux下高效备份Oracle数据库技巧
Linux系统下轻松卸载QEMU教程
超跑风范,Hyper Tourer极速之旅
Linux系统CPU占用超1000%?揭秘原因
远程挂载Linux文件系统教程